: : > Have you tried porting -current's umodem driver back to stable?  I
: : > think it would work a lot better...
: : 
: : I've glanced at CURRENT's umodem and there is no that code
: : allowing to work with devices without CM descriptor using UNION instead...
: : NetBSD has that code since 2005.
: :
: : Do you think CURRENT's umodem would be useble in this case?
: 
: My modem doesn't have a CM descriptor and I quirked it before.  I
: removed the quirk code and it works now without it.  The Union code
: from NetBSD didn't look relevant at all when you chased down all the
: things that it actually did, but maybe I missed something.
: 
: Given that umodem from current should just work on -stable w/o any
: changes (you may need ucom too, which does need one or two changes),
: it would be worth a shot at trying it.

If that doesn't work, btw, I'll port the union code over.
